The quality of a bunk bed for children is determined by the materials used, its design and layout. Look for a model that has sturdy guardrails, that should be at least 5 inches high, as per the Consumer Product Safety Commission. Be sure that the top buy bunk bed is not too close to window sills or ceiling. This can lead to dangerous falls.

If you have children who are young you must be careful when picking a bunk bed. Wait until your child is old enough to sleep comfortably on the top bunk. This usually happens about six years old. This will ensure that your child has the strength and confidence to climb the ladder in the evening.

The majority of bunk beds come with assembly instructions. It is essential to follow the directions carefully. You may also want to ask a family member or friend to assist you. If you're not comfortable using power tools, consider hiring a professional to assemble the bed for you.
